About the role



The Executive, Packaging Development is responsible to support the execution of technology transfer activities by preparing and reviewing technical documents, assisting in scale-up and validation, and collaborating across functions, ensuring data integrity and compliance with cGMP in pharmaceutical manufacturing.

Key Responsibilities:

Assist to develop, design cost effective and review packaging solutions for products such as Master Packaging Records, considering factors such as product stability, safety and regulatory requirements. Assist to evaluate and select packaging materials that meet pharmaceutical industry standards and regulatory requirements, including considerations for compatibility with drug formulations and container closure systems. Ensure packaging designs comply with relevant regulations and guidelines from regulatory bodies such as NPRA, FDA or others globally. This includes requirements for labeling, child resistance, tamper evidence, and serialization. Implement quality assurance processes to maintain consistent packaging quality, including developing packaging specifications, and implementing appropriate controls. Assist in packaging development projects from concept through to commercialization, collaborating with cross-functional teams including R&D, regulatory affairs, production, and quality assurance. Responsible to maintain accurate documentation of packaging development activities, prepare and review of all packaging development SOPs, specification and STP. Identify and implement opportunities for packaging standardization and automation in order to improve cost. Evaluation of packaging materials and execution of trials. Supporting to cross functional teams to achieve the project timelines. Investigations related to packaging (development and operation) issues. Conducting batches at CMOs (if required) Review of artworks and ensuring the approved artworks feasibility with respect to operations. Support to production for change part qualification.
